What is the cheapest month to fly from Winnipeg to Philadelphia?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Winnipeg to Philadelphia,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Winnipeg to Philadelphia is November, where tickets cost C$ 340 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are February and August,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is C$ 1,465 and C$ 1,194 respectively.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Winnipeg to Philadelphia?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ly to Philadelphia with an airline and back to Winnipeg with another airline.
